N.J.S.A. 40:41A-33

Qualifications, election, term

40:41A-33. Qualifications, election, term The county executive shall be a qualified voter of the county residing in the county. He shall be elected from the county at large for a term of 4 years commencing on January 1 next following his election. L.1972, c. 154, s. 33, eff. Sept. 19, 1972.
